int sfall_func2("get_window_attribute", int winType, int attrType)
|
||||||
|
- returns the attribute of the specified interface window by the attrType argument
|
||||||
|
- winType: the type number of the interface window (see WINTYPE_* constants in sfall.h)
|
||||||
|
- attrType: 0 - X position, 1 - Y position (relative to the top-left corner of the game screen)
